U.N. Starts Sending Aid Across Border to Iraq
From Times Wire Reports
The United Nations said it had sent its first shipment of aid across the Turkish border into Kurdish-controlled northern Iraq since the start of the U.S.-led war.
Two trucks carrying water purification equipment, medicine and educational material for UNICEF passed through the Habur border gate in southeastern Turkey.
U.N. officials said $4 million worth of supplies would follow in coming days.
